The Hindi department of CT Public School observed Hindi Diwas on 14th September with great reverence.
The students designed posters and students of classes’ I-V framed slogans emphasizing on the importance of Hindi while the students of grade VI-X wrote poems and quotes of great writers accentuating the importance of Hindi.
Principal, Mrs Suman Rana informed the students that Hindi was adopted as the Official Language of the Union of India. Later in 1950, the Constitution of India declared Hindi in the Devanagari script as the Official language of India. She said that Hindi is one of the main languages of India and is spoken by around 40% of the Indian population. Hindi takes pride in being the mother tongue of 180 million people and the second language of 300 million people. She also asserted that the children should be adept in Hindi, English and their mother tongue and should give equal regard to all the languages.
